    Can You Return a Cashier's Check? Understanding Refunds and Cancellations

    Cashier's checks, often perceived as guaranteed funds, present a unique situation when it comes to returns. Unlike personal checks that can be easily stopped, the process of returning a cashier's check is more complex and depends heavily on the circumstances. This article explores the possibilities and limitations surrounding cashier's check returns.

    Understanding the Nature of a Cashier's Check

    A cashier's check is a check drawn by a bank against its own funds. It's considered a more secure form of payment than a personal check because the bank guarantees payment, unlike personal checks which rely on the individual's account balance. This guaranteed nature is why returning one is less straightforward.

    Scenarios Where Returning a Cashier's Check Might Be Possible:

    • Before Negotiation: If the check hasn't been cashed or deposited, you have the highest chance of success. Contact the issuing bank immediately. Explain the situation and request cancellation. They may require documentation supporting your reason for the return. This is the ideal situation and usually involves simply voiding the check.

    • After Negotiation, But Before Funds are Available: There’s a small window of opportunity if the check has been deposited but the funds haven't yet cleared. This requires swift action and direct communication with both the recipient and the issuing bank. The recipient might need to return the check, or the bank might facilitate a reversal. This depends entirely on the bank's policies.

    • Errors or Fraud: If the cashier's check was issued due to an error (incorrect amount, wrong payee) or is suspected to be fraudulent, you'll need to immediately report this to the issuing bank. They will investigate and might be able to cancel or reverse the transaction. Providing evidence is crucial in these situations.

    Scenarios Where Returning a Cashier's Check is Highly Unlikely:

    • After Funds have Cleared: Once the funds are fully accessible to the recipient, reversing the transaction is extremely difficult. The recipient legally owns the funds, making a forced return improbable without legal intervention.

    • Recipient Refusal: Even if you manage to contact the recipient and explain the situation, they are under no obligation to return the money. This highlights the importance of preventing the check from being cashed in the first place.

    • Lack of Cooperation: If the issuing bank is uncooperative, your chances of a successful return diminish significantly. This emphasizes the importance of choosing a reputable financial institution when acquiring a cashier's check.

    Tips to Minimize the Need for a Return:

    • Double-Check Details: Before issuing or accepting a cashier's check, meticulously verify all details: amount, payee name, and any other relevant information. This helps to avoid errors.
    • Clear Communication: Maintain open communication with the recipient throughout the transaction. This prevents misunderstandings and makes a potential return conversation easier.
    • Choose Reputable Banks: When acquiring a cashier's check, opt for a reliable and established bank to ensure smoother processes and better customer service.

    Legal Considerations:

    Attempting to force a return after the check has been cashed might involve legal processes, which can be expensive and time-consuming. It's crucial to understand your legal rights and options before pursuing such actions. Legal counsel may be necessary depending on the complexity of the situation.
